FORT WORTH, Texas: Texas Wesleyan University is proud to announce that standout golfer Malisone Chanthapanya has been selected to compete as an individual in the prestigious 2023 NAIA Women's Golf Championship. The tournament is scheduled from May 23 to 26, 2023, at the renowned TPC Deer Run in Silvis, IL.
Chanthapanya, a sophomore at Texas Wesleyan, has consistently demonstrated her exceptional skills and dedication to the sport throughout her collegiate career. With an impressive record of accomplishments, including multiple tournament victories and all-conference honors, she has proven to be one of the finest golfers in the nation.
"As disappointed as I am for the team to miss out this year, I'm extremely proud of Mali for qualifying as an individual," Head Coach Kevin Millikan said. "Her work ethic and dedication to the game have earned her recognition as one of the top players in the NAIA, and I know we're both excited to see what she can accomplish this week."
The NAIA Women's Golf Championship is widely regarded as one of the premier collegiate golf events, attracting top talent from across the country. Chanthapanya's selection as an individual participant is a testament to her outstanding abilities and the immense respect she has earned within the golfing community.
"It's great to see Malisone earn her way into the National Championships. She can play with anyone in the country and has a real shot to make a run at the title," Athletic Director Ricky Dotson said. "We are extremely proud of her accomplishments both on the course and in the classroom. I think she will play extremely well and represent Texas Wesleyan in a great way."
Chanthapanya is scheduled to start the tournament on Tuesday at 2 pm on the tenth hole. She will play with two other golfers, Serah Khanyereri of St. Thomas and Hannah Ulibarri of the Masters.
